Занимаюсь frontend разработкой более 10 лет.
Ответственно подхожу к любым задачам, легко адаптируюсь под условия проекта и с удовольствием использую новые инструменты в разработке для наилучшего результата.
Используемый стек технологий: Javascript, Typescript, React, Redux, HTML, CSS, Webpack.
Навыки работы:
- создание архитектуры, разработка проектов и создание интерфейсов на React + Redux;
- адаптивная и кроссбраузерная верстка;
- умение работать с Webpack и настраивать его под нужды проекта;
- английский язык на уровне B1. Возможность переписки и чтения документации на английском языке.
Задействованный стек: JavaScript, React, Redux, Redux-Saga, Material UI, CSS, HTML, Адаптивная верстка, Webpack.
В компании работал над 3 проектами:
- SPA приложение для лизинга автомобилей.
- SSR приложение заказа и доставки еды азиатской кухни, работающей на территории РФ
- SSR приложение для компании сотовой связи, работающей на территории Урала.
В рамках этих проектов занимался следующими задачами:
- разработка SPA приложений с использованием как React Hooks, так и классовых компонентов;
- создание интерфейсов и форм с плотным взаимодействием backend разработчиков и дизайнеров;
- реализация двухфакторной автризации;
- SSO авторизация с помощью интеграции сервера аутентификации Blitz;
- разработка оплаты заказов по банковским картам и СБП. Усовершенствование удобства работы с корзиной для пользователей на основе промокодов, бонусов и программы лояльности;
- поддержка продуктов с использованием классовых компонентов на React;
- разработка и усовершенствование продуктов на последней версии React с помощью React Hooks;
- адаптивная верстка на основе макетов Figma. Кастомизация готовых модулей и компонентов на основе шаблонов макетов дизайнера;
- введение более удобных и функциональных практик для быстрой разработки новых и существующих систем;
- работа в команде и участие в код ревью.
Задействованный стек: JavaScript, React, Next.js, Redux, Styled-Components, CSS, HTML, Адаптивная верстка, Webpack.
В рамках проекта занимался разработкой поддерживающих веб систем для администрирования игр, написание лендингов для продуктов команды.
Поддержка и создание веб графиков и таблиц для геймдизайнеров для отслеживания статистики игроков и динамики развития игр.
Перевод лендингов на SSR для поисковых роботов с использованием возможностей Next.js.
Разработка web-систем на Next.js для компьютерных игр, адаптивная верстка лендингов.
Задействованный стек: JavaScript, Typescript, React, GraphQL, CSS, HTML, Webpack.
Принимал участие в разработке веб приложения для ведения цифрового бухгалтерского учета.
В рамках проекта занимался следующими задачами:
- авторизация клиентов на сервисе;
- разработка интерфейсов для создания и пересчета учета товаров;
- разработка интерфейса для формирования содержимого чеков и ценников товаров;
- плотное взаимодействие с backend разработчиками и дизайнерами;
- адаптивная верстка макетов;
- взаимодействие с GraphQL и написание запросов и мутаций для него;
- участие в код-ревью.
Задействованный стек: Javascript, React, Redux, HTML, CSS, Webpack.
Разработка веб приложения на React, для администрирования продуктов компании.
Адаптиваная верстка лендингов по макетам для внутренних проектов.
Разработка архитектуры, программирование на React и верстка сайта в сфере финансовых услуг https://vataga.trade.
- работа с сокетами, графиками и картами
Разработка логики и связи с сервером для мобильной RPG игры.
Верстка и программирование сайта https://openi.ru/openh.
- реализация калькулятора для просчета стоимости взнова за покупку квартиры;
- программирование визуальных графиков сроков;
Верстка и программирование сайтов на AngularJS:
- сайт для доставки товаров по магазинам;
- найм и управление сотрудниками между компаниями, распределение по датам и времени;
- букинговое агенство для аренды жилых помещений
- верстка и программирование клиентской части мобильного приложения Easy.Futbol для сбора, организации и управления футбольных команд
Верстка веб-сайтов.
Верстка веб-сайтов.